Biogen has acquired Alcyone, a distinguished self-catering guesthouse located in the beach village of Summerstrand, Port Elizabeth, South Africa, for an undisclosed amount. Alcyone, often described as a "Diamond in Port Elizabeth" and known for its "5-star hospitality," operates from its prime address at 29 Admiralty Way in Summerstrand, Gqeberha, Eastern Cape. The guesthouse provides high-quality accommodation services, catering specifically to guests seeking premium self-catering options in this popular coastal region. Its established reputation for excellence and strategic location have firmly positioned it as a significant asset within the local hospitality sector, attracting both leisure and business travelers.
